Numerical Simulation of the Elastic–Plastic Ejection from Grooved Aluminum Surfaces Under Double Supported Shocks Using the SPH Method

The ejection of disturbed surfaces under multiple shocks is a critical phenomenon in pyrotechnic and inertial confinement fusion.
